What Is an Online Driver License?An online driver license describes the capability for individuals to obtain, renew, or upgrade their driver's license through an internet website operated by their state's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) or comparable company. This procedure generally removes the need for in-person check outs, reducing wait times and making the entire experience more user-friendly.
How Do Online Driver Licenses Work?The procedures and regulations surrounding online driver licenses can vary substantially from one state to another. However, the basic circulation usually consists of the following steps:
Eligibility Check: Applicants need to initially figure out if they are eligible for online services. Most states permit applicants who are renewing or replacing an existing license to do so online, while newbie candidates might still be needed to go to a DMV office.
Producing an Account: Users generally need to produce an account on the state's DMV website. This may consist of offering individual information such as their driver's license number, social security number, and e-mail address.
Submitting Application: The next step involves completing the application, which can frequently be submitted online. Candidates will need to provide necessary identification and any other needed documents.
Payment: After verifying eligibility and finishing the application, candidates typically need to pay a charge, which can often be done utilizing credit or debit cards.
Receiving the License: If the application is authorized, the brand-new or restored driver's license will be sent by mail to the candidate's home address.
Transitioning to an online system for getting driver licenses provides numerous advantages. Here are some essential advantages:
1. Convenience
- 24/7 Access: Individuals can apply for or restore their licenses at any time, getting rid of the constraints of workplace hours.
- Avoiding Long Lines: This system reduces the need for waiting in long lines at DMV offices, which can frequently be a lengthy endeavor.
2. Efficiency
- Faster Processing: Online applications might be processed more quickly than traditional in-person requests.
- Simplified Forms: Online platforms frequently supply user-friendly kinds that assist applicants through the necessary actions, minimizing the opportunity of mistakes.
3. Eco-friendly
- Decreased Paperwork: The digital nature of online driver licenses decreases the amount of paper utilized in applications and license issuance.
- Lower Carbon Footprint: Fewer trips to the DMV mean less time spent driving, leading to a lower general carbon emissions.
4. Improved Security
- Protect Payment Methods: Online systems use safe payment processing approaches, providing peace of mind for candidates.
- Identity Verification: Many online systems include steps for verifying identity, even more boosting security.
5. Enhanced Access for All
- Remote Options: Individuals living in remote locations may find it simpler to access online services than to take a trip to the nearby DMV.
- Accessible Resources: Those with specials needs can typically discover it simpler to navigate online systems instead of in-person visits.
